Default Help, fish death!

I could some some diagnostic help.

The situation:
- Found 1 dead benggai cardinal fish stuck to the MP10 today
- Other cardinals and clownfish are NOT eating
- Introduced 9 cerith snails + 1 hermit last weekend (no quarantine)
- Prior to that, last livestock change was 4 months ago (from quarantine)
- No white spots on surviving fish
- Water params reasonable and stable
- Last weekend, installed an ATS (really just put a white plastic mesh in the sump horizontally and a light bulb)
- Water params stable, using controller for ATO and temp
- ph: 7.7 - 8.1
- Ammonia/nitrite/nitrate: 0/0/0
- salinity: 38ppt (I have been lowering at rate of 1ppt/week)

Have I introduced marine ich or velvet? Other possibilities?
